Output 26ec023fef0a928b57c842af211b74f3960b2baab89ad395c64b1d7e941ddc94:2

value
6383654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87424d32ae67d1d0b44c683cbd4527c8c9491869 OP_EQUAL
address
3E2Ca9s5WwBxXhMZXorxWZMwH2n6wBqPeY
transaction
26ec023fef0a928b57c842af211b74f3960b2baab89ad395c64b1d7e941ddc94
spent
true